The Nittany Lion Inn, established in 1931, stands as the top hotel in State College, offering a blend of comfort and quality rooted in Penn State tradition.
Guests can expect an unparalleled experience that seamlessly combines modern amenities with a rich history, making for a truly unforgettable stay.
Generated from their website's infomation